There are moments in Scripture where Jesus expresses His will with remarkable clarity. In this verse, He gives a command that reaches beyond words and intentions and moves directly into daily life: love one another.


This command is not based on human standards of love, which often change with circumstances and emotions. Instead, Jesus points to His own example. The measure of Christian love is the love Christ demonstrated through His life, sacrifice, compassion, and grace.


In a world marked by division, conflict, and self-interest, this truth brings clarity. Followers of Christ are called to reflect the same love they have received from Him.

Bible Verse

John 15:12 “This is my commandment, that you love one another, even as I have loved you.”



Daily Application


John 15:12 teaches that Christian love is not merely an emotion but a choice expressed through actions, attitudes, and relationships. Jesus calls believers to love others according to His example rather than according to personal preference or convenience.


Love is commanded: Jesus presents love as an essential part of following Him

Christ is the example: The standard of love is found in His life and sacrifice

Love is practical: Genuine love is demonstrated through actions, patience, forgiveness, and service


This verse calls us to reflect the love of Christ in our relationships and interactions with others.

Understanding the Context of John 15


The Gospel of John was written to reveal Jesus as the Son of God and to lead people to believe in Him. In John 15, Jesus is teaching His disciples during the final hours before His crucifixion.


Earlier in the chapter, Jesus describes Himself as the true vine and teaches the importance of abiding in Him. Fruitfulness, obedience, and love are all connected to remaining in Christ.


John 15:12 stands at the center of this teaching. After speaking about abiding in His love, Jesus gives a direct command: love one another as He has loved them.


This love is not based on personal benefit or human affection alone. It reflects the selfless, sacrificial love that Jesus would soon demonstrate through the cross.


This passage reminds us:


  • Jesus calls His followers to love one another

  • His love is the model for Christian relationships

  • Love is evidence of a life connected to Christ

Practical Ways to Reflect Christ’s Love Daily


The love Jesus describes is lived out through everyday choices and interactions. Small acts of faithfulness often become powerful expressions of Christ's love.


  • Show patience: Respond with grace rather than frustration

  • Offer forgiveness: Release bitterness and choose reconciliation when possible

  • Encourage others: Speak words that strengthen and uplift

  • Serve with humility: Look for opportunities to help without seeking recognition

  • Pray for others: Bring their needs before God regularly


As this becomes part of daily life:


  • Relationships become healthier

  • Compassion grows deeper

  • Unity becomes stronger

  • Grace becomes more visible

  • Life reflects Christ more clearly


Love grows when it is practiced faithfully.
